Ironton Rail Trail – Dog-Friendly Walks in Whitehall Township, Pennsylvania

If you’re looking for a scenic and dog-friendly spot in Whitehall Township, Pennsylvania, the Water Street parking area along the Ironton Rail Trail is a great choice. The trail offers a picturesque setting ideal for pet owners seeking pet-friendly trails for leisurely dog walking, running, or even biking. The trail is known for its well-paved, flat 5-mile loop, making it a popular destination for dog owners looking for an accessible and enjoyable outing with their pets.

While the parking area is convenient and rarely full, it is not paved, so be prepared for potential muddy conditions after rain. The site generally features a portable restroom (condition may vary throughout the year), and the picturesque/paved paths make it perfect for dog-friendly hiking. Although this area isn’t a traditional fenced dog park, it’s an excellent starting point for long walks with your furry friend on a leash and enjoying the beautiful local scenery.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Are there restrooms available for owners? Yes, a portable toilet is usually available at the parking area.
  • Is the parking area paved? No, the parking area is not paved and can become muddy after rain.
  • Are there walking or hiking trails connected to the park? Yes, the Ironton Rail Trail offers a well-paved, 5-mile loop for walking, running, and biking.
  • Is the park regularly cleaned and maintained? Yes, reviewers mention the trail and area are nicely kept and clean.
  • Is there winter maintenance (snow removal, etc.)? Plowing in winter is described as spotty, so winter access may be inconsistent.
